We have had numerous clients request that the designated role(s) be added to matched users when a batch of e-mail addresses (sometimes a few thousand) are added to the pre-approved list.

Currently, if you add an e-mail, say foo@bar.com to have the role "member" but the user has already registered on the site, the module throws an error and requires the user to sift through the (sometimes very long) list to find and remove any subscribers already registered.

Many of our clients are membership associations, and they will dump a member list into the register pre-approved box. Often, those seeking membership privileges have already registered on the site.

I recognize this is a "pre-registration" module by design, however, it has the potential to manage roles by domain and serve many other useful functions. Offering a setting to users to add the roles to the users/domains that already exist on the site would be very helpful.

Imagine if you were an organization that allowed various companies to have member access by domain name, but the domains were updated each year. You could simply use the bulk operations module to clear the member role from all users on the site, then drop in a new list of the approved domains into the register pre-approved module and poof -- all users from the pre-approved domains would be members, and the others would not.

I've been giving this feature request some additional thought and believe it could be integrated quite nicely. The idea would be to provide 2 checkboxes when adding new patterns: one for assigning a role (or roles) to existing individual email addresses and another for existing email addresses matching a domain name. The latter would create a little overhead (depending on the number of patterns and user accounts), but it's only executed deliberately and incidentally so the impact would be minimal and momentary.
